6.内置函数

内置函数
abs() 求绝对值
all(iterable) 所有元素都为真就返回真
any(iterable) 任一元素为真就返回真
bin() 十进制转二进制
callable() 判断对象是否可调用
chr(int) 通过括号内的数字返回该数字在ascii码中的内容
ord("char") 通过括号内的字母返回该字母对应的ascii码
compile() 底层的编译转码,一般用不着
dir() 查看括号内的对象有哪些方法
enumerate(sequence, [start=0])
eval() 字符串转换成字典
filter()
map() 这两个配合lambda使用,等回来研究完lambda再看
frozenset() 不可变的集合
globals() 返回当前程序的所有变量的键值对字典
hash(o) 返回object的哈希值
hex(x) 把一个数字转换成16进制
oct(x) 转8进制
id() 返回内存地址
pow(x,y) 返回x的y次方
reversed(seq) 序列反转
round(float,x) 把一个float保留x位小数,默认为0位小数
sorted(dict) 返回一个dict.key的排序列表
zip(list1,list2)

猜你喜欢

转载自www.cnblogs.com/huohu121/p/12241067.html